Understanding the EPL Table
The English Premier League (EPL) is one of the most watched football leagues in the world, renowned for its competitive nature and unpredictability. The EPL table serves as a key indicator of team performance throughout the season, outlining the standings of all competing clubs based on points accumulated from wins, draws, and losses.
Current Standings as of October 2023
As of mid-October 2023, the EPL table has seen some surprising developments. Arsenal currently leads the league, showcasing a strong offensive and defensive performance. Following closely is Manchester City, the defending champions, who are known for their depth in squad and tactical mastery. Other teams like Liverpool, Chelsea, and Manchester United are in a tightly contested race, aiming for those coveted Champions League spots. The battle for relegation is equally fierce, with teams like Burnley and Sheffield United struggling at the bottom of the table, fighting to secure their place in England’s top-flight football.
